Lucas: Toughest year, but vows top return to São Paulo

Imagem do artigo:Lucas: Toughest year, but vows top return to São Paulo

The year 2025 is definitely over for São Paulo, after their participation in the Brasileirão, where they finished in 8th place. It is a time for reflection, analysis, and promises, as Lucas Moura did after what he called the ‘most difficult season of his career’.

After striker Calleri took to social media to express himself and vent, it was Lucas’s turn to use the internet this Monday (8) for his final thoughts on the tricolor year and a promise to work hard to come back strong.


Vídeos OneFootball


“Another season comes to an end, and this one, 2025, certainly wasn’t what I imagined. On the contrary, it was, without a doubt, the most challenging and difficult season of my career. The injury in March changed my year, and that’s when my fight began. The recovery has been much slower, tougher, and more complex than any of us imagined.

This period is forcing me to face my limits and adjust my processes. It’s been a huge trial, but it won’t defeat me! The GOD I serve is greater than any problem! And the focus is clear: to return in 2026 at my highest level, the level I demand of myself. No shortcuts, no outside expectations, but with a lot of hard work, consistency, and daily discipline.

I am grateful to GOD for another completed season. Regardless of anything, He sustained me, He brought me this far, He is my foundation! I want to sincerely thank everyone who is supporting me and rooting for my recovery, thank you very much.

GOD bless you all! See you in 2026. São Paulo is a Feeling,” posted Lucas Moura on his Instagram.

The number 7 for São Paulo suffered from a serious problem in his right knee, which began after the semifinal loss to Palmeiras in the Paulistão, back in March. On the 29th of that month, the club announced trauma to the right knee of their star, which sidelined him for ten matches.

From that point on, there were months of frustrated and premature attempts at a comeback, which never fully materialized. Finally, in November, he was sidelined for good due to the endless pain in his right knee, which still hasn’t been resolved by the end of the season. He missed 36 games due to physical problems.

The last medical update released by the club, on Saturday (6), reported that after medication was applied to the painful area in his right knee, the attacking midfielder continues treatment and is also doing muscle strengthening and motor control work with physiotherapy. As reported by AVANTE MEU TRICOLOR, Lucas gave up part of his vacation to continue treatment at the Barra Funda training center.
